Home Jobs Board Software Engineer, iStreamPlanet, September 23

Software Engineer, iStreamPlanet, September 23

IstreamWho: iStreamPlanet
Position: Software Engineer
Where: Redmond
What: Are you critical, analytical and skeptical? Do you like breaking things? Do you describe yourself as a QA Ninja? Are you interested in developing cutting-edge technology that delivers live video streaming over the Internet? Live streaming is exploding and now is the time to capitalize on this opportunity.

iStreamPlanet, the leader in online live event and live linear broadcasting is looking for strong SDETs to help us deliver world class products and services in a cloud infrastructure. Aventus, our flagship product, is being built from the ground up for the cloud…running on commodity hardware and virtualized environments.

The ideal candidate is a rock star tester that is energized by working in a dynamic environment, embraces the challenges of building products from the ground up and is passionate about delivering best in class, scalable services. The candidate will play a significant role in the design and testing of a media workflow system to control one channel of video or thousands.

The candidate will work to analyze our current set of test cases and software architecture to determine how best to automate tests and validate the results. You will develop new tests as needed by analyzing technologies in-house as well as 3rd party tools to determine which will work best in the target environment. The end goal is to facilitate a highly efficient QA team and to reduce time to market for features and bugs fixes. Core technology involves testing audio/video streams as well as functional aspects of cloud computing. If you are familiar with technologies such as H.264, MPEG-2 Transport Streams, HLS, HDS, Smooth Streaming or cloud computing then this is the job for you!

Responsibilities:

  • Develop Automated Test tools
  • Identify and drive development of automated QA solutions wherever possible
  • Creation of test plans
  • Manual Testing as needed

Requirements:

  • BS in Computer Science or equivalent experience/skills
  • 5+ years of professional experience developing and executing automated test suites, experience diagnosing, reporting, tracking and resolving quality issues
  • Knowledge of Performance/Stress testing methodology
  • Experience working with audio/video streams is a plus
  • Knowledge of digital video encoding and compression technologies is a plus
  • Familiarity with C#, C++, Visual Studio, JSON, REST, SOAP

How: Apply Here